Output e8fa40482b4a06cdb3b7dfed834f86044b2387293f4dcc0062b0f53780663646:2

value
9364
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fe0e53da304067e1aa9e8352de2bc860fd26789b16ff38f65aa30e1da361b9b0
address
tb1plc898k3sgpn7r257sdfdu27gvr7jv7ymzmln3aj65v8pmgmphxcqt4aqt3
transaction
e8fa40482b4a06cdb3b7dfed834f86044b2387293f4dcc0062b0f53780663646
confirmations
53995
spent
true